The Spanish phrase “Lo siento, no puedo hablar ahora” communicates an inability to engage in conversation at the present moment. A direct English rendering of this expression is “I’m sorry, I can’t talk right now.” This phrase is commonly employed to politely decline a conversation due to time constraints, other commitments, or an inconvenient setting.

The Spanish phrase “Lo siento, no puedo hablar ahora” directly translates to “I’m sorry, I can’t talk right now” in English. It is a common expression used to politely decline a conversation due to current unavailability. The phrase consists of several components: “Lo siento” (I’m sorry), “no puedo” (I can’t), “hablar” (to talk), and “ahora” (now). This construction conveys a temporary inability to engage in dialogue.
